Mick Jagger has praised Yungblud and Machine Gun Kelly, saying that the two artists bring ‘life’ to a new generation of rock music.
Speaking to Swedish radio station P4 recently, the Rolling Stones frontman explained (via The Independent): ‘In rock music you need energy and there have not been a lot of new rock singers around. Now there are a few.’ He continued: ‘You have Yungblud and Machine Gun Kelly. That kind of post-punk vibe makes me think there is still a bit of life in rock and roll.’
Elsewhere in the interview, Jagger, 78, shut down the possibility of retiring following the Stones’ UK and European 60th anniversary tour which is due to kick off in June.
